What this means
MAPLEBEAR DBA INSTACART applied to sponsor 352 workers for green cards between 2018 and 2024. A green card application is what an employer files to help a worker stay in the U.S. permanently.
Important: everything on this page is derived from public U.S. Department of Labor records. It is not a statement of fraud, wrongdoing, or hiring intent. It describes observable filing patterns only.
